/* Galleria Miniml Theme 2012-04-04 | http://galleria.io/license/ | (c) Aino */

#galleria-loader {
	height:1px!important
}
.galleria-container {
    position: relative;
    font:13px/17px "MS Sans Serif", Geneva, sans-serif;
    background:#ffffff;
}
.galleria-container img {
    -moz-user-select: none;
    -webkit-user-select: none;
    -o-user-select: none;
}
.galleria-stage {
    position: absolute;
    top: 0px;
	bottom: 20px;
    left: 0px;
    right: 0px;
    overflow:hidden;
}
.galleria-dots {
    position:absolute;
	width: 380px;
	left: 0px;
	bottom:-135px;
    height:100px;
}
.galleria-dots div {
	position: relative;
    width:20px;
    height:20px;
	margin-bottom:5px;
    margin-right:5px;
    background:#dddddd no-repeat;
    float:left;
    cursor:pointer;
}
.galleria-container.notouch .galleria-dots div:hover,
.galleria-container.touch .galleria-dots div:active {
    background-color:#ababab;
}
.galleria-dots div.active {
    background-color:#bababa;
}


.galleria-fs,
.galleria-thumbs,
.galleria-more {
    width:10px;
    height:10px;
	margin-right: 12px;
    cursor:pointer;
    background:#dddddd url(/public/js/galleria/fs.png) no-repeat;
    position:absolute;
    bottom:0;
    right:-12px;
}

.galleria-thumbs{
    background-image:url(/public/js/galleria/thumb.png);
    right:15px;
	margin-right:10px;
}
.galleria-more{
    background-image:url(/public/js/galleria/info.png);
    right:45px;
	margin-right:5px;
}


.galleria-container.notouch .galleria-fs:hover,
.galleria-container.notouch .galleria-thumbs:hover,
.galleria-container.notouch .galleria-more:hover,
.galleria-container.touch .galleria-fs:active,
.galleria-container.touch .galleria-thumbs:active,
.galleria-container.touch .galleria-more:active,
.galleria-thumbs.active,
.galleria-more.active {
    background-color: #ababab;
}
.fullscreen .galleria-stage{
    bottom:100px;
}
.fullscreen .galleria-fs {
    right:10px;
    bottom:15px;
    background-image:url(/public/js/galleria/fs.png);
}
.fullscreen .galleria-thumbs {
    right:45px;
    bottom:15px;
}
.fullscreen .galleria-more {
    right:80px;
    bottom:15px;
}
.fullscreen .galleria-info {
    bottom:100px;
	margin-left:21px;
}
.fullscreen .galleria-dots {
	bottom:0px;
	height:58px;
	margin-left:20px;
}
.fullscreen .galleria-thumbnails-container{
    bottom:15px;
}
.galleria-counter {
    display:none;
}
.galleria-loader {
	width:30px;
	height:30px;
	background:#fff url(/public/js/galleria/loader.gif) no-repeat 50% 50%;
	position:absolute;
	top:50%;
	left:50%;
	margin-top:-15px;
	margin-left:-15px;
	z-index:3;
	display:none
}
.galleria-info {
    position: absolute;
    bottom:7px;
	float:left;
    height:10px;
    line-height:18px;
}
	.galleria-info a{color: #5D6366; text-decoration:none;}
	.galleria-info a:hover{color: #2C2B27; text-decoration:underline;}
	.galleria-info a:active{color: #5D6366; text-decoration:none;}
	.galleria-info a:visited {color: #5D6366; text-decoration:none;}
	
.galleria-info-title {
	position: relative;
	top: 4px;
    left:-391px;
    display: block;
    color:#5D6366;
}
	.galleria-info-title a{color: #5D6366; text-decoration:none;}
	.galleria-info-title a:hover{color: #2C2B27; text-decoration:underline;}
	.galleria-info-title a:active{color: #5D6366; text-decoration:none;}
	.galleria-info-title a:visited {color: #5D6366; text-decoration:none;}

.galleria-info-description {
    display:none!important;
}
.galleria-desc {
    position:absolute;
    width:70%;
    top:47%;
    left:13.5%;
    margin-left:0;
    background:#fff;
    border:3px solid #dddddd;
    padding:8px;
    z-index:2;
    font:11px/14px "MS Sans Serif", Geneva, sans-serif;
    display:none;
    color:#5D6366;
    cursor:pointer;
}
	.galleria-desc a{color: #5D6366; text-decoration:none;}
	.galleria-desc a:hover{color: #2C2B27; text-decoration:underline;}
	.galleria-desc a:active{color: #5D6366; text-decoration:none;}
	.galleria-desc a:visited {color: #5D6366; text-decoration:none;}
	
.galleria-desc.hover{
    background:#fff url(/public/js/galleria/bye.png) no-repeat 100% 2px;
}

.galleria-desc strong{
    color:#5D6366;
    font-weight:normal;
    margin-bottom:5px;
    display:block;
}
.galleria-desc p{
    margin-bottom:0;
}
.galleria-image-nav {
    display:none;
}
.galleria-thumbnails-container {
    position:absolute;
    top:15px;
    bottom:20px;
    left:0;
    right:0;
    background:url(/public/js/galleria/bgwhite.png);
    z-index:2;
    overflow:hidden;
    visibility: hidden;
}
.galleria-thumbnails {
    margin: 10px 10px 0px 10px;
}
.galleria-thumbnails .galleria-image {
    height: 124px;
    width:124px;
    background: #ababab;
    margin: 6px 7px 6px 5px;
    float: left;
    cursor: pointer;
    -moz-box-shadow: 0 0 2px rgb(0,0,0);
	-webkit-box-shadow: 0 0 2px rgb(0,0,0);
    box-shadow: 0 0 2px rgb(0,0,0);
}
.galleria-container.notouch .galleria-thumbnails .galleria-image img:hover,
.galleria-container.touch .galleria-thumbnails .galleria-image img:active {
    opacity:.1!important;
    filter: alpha(opacity=05)!important;
}